在Silverlight 5中使用Dynamic JSON - 无法正常工作

时间:2014-04-09 12:58:04

标签: c# silverlight json.net

使用c#动态类型将JSON数组添加到JObject中是否适用于Silverlight?

我已将最新的JSON.NET 6.0.2安装到VS2012中。我想使用'动态'在我的c#代码中创建一个JSON对象。方法如文档中所示。但它在运行时并不起作用。我在添加JArray时遇到错误,它指出"' Newtonsoft.Json.Linq.JObject'不包含'章节""。

的定义

示例代码:

dynamic state = new JObject();
state.Add("Date", DateTime.Now);  // works
state.Sections = new JArray() as dynamic;  // fails

1 个答案:

答案 0 :(得分:0)

我正在做同样的事情并且它在最新版本中正常工作..现在 您可以使用动态

进行序列化和反序列化
cell.animal.text[0] = animalarray[0]
cell.animal.hidden = true